Record and Growth:
Internet poker emerged within the late 1990s due to advancements in technology and the net. The very first online poker room, Planet Poker, premiered in 1998, attracting a tiny but enthusiastic community. But was in the early 2000s that on-line Poker online experienced exponential growth, mostly as a result of the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.

Popularity and Accessibility:
One of many known reasons for the immense interest in online poker is its availability. People can log on to their favorite internet poker systems anytime, from everywhere, using their computers or cellular devices. This convenience features attracted a varied player base, which range from leisure players to experts, contributing to the fast expansion of online poker.

Features of Internet Poker:
On-line poker provides several advantages over standard brick-and-mortar gambling enterprises. Firstly, it provides a larger selection of game choices, including different poker alternatives and stakes, catering into choices and spending plans of types of people. Furthermore, on-line poker areas tend to be available 24/7, getting rid of the limitations of actual casino operating hours. In addition, web platforms often offer attractive bonuses, respect programs, in addition to power to play numerous tables simultaneously, improving the overall gaming experience.

Challenges and Regulation:
Whilst the online poker business thrives, it faces challenges in the shape of legislation and security concerns. Governing bodies global have actually implemented varying quantities of legislation to safeguard people and avoid deceptive activities. In addition, online poker systems need powerful safety steps to shield people' personal and monetary information, making sure a safe playing environment.
